izumu meaning in english

Word: இழுமு - The tamil word have 5 characters and have more than one meaning in english.
izumu means
1. producing the one of the four basic taste sensations that is not bitter, sour, or salt.
2. fair, as weather

Transliteration : iẕumu Other spellings : izumu

Meanings in english :

pleasantness agreeableness

Meaning of izumu in tamil

tittippu / தித்திப்பு
Tamil to English
English To Tamil